devmoa

GitHub의 Merge, Squash and Merge, Rebase and Merge 정확히 이해하기

NHN·2018년 9월 20일·00
GitGitHubMergeSquash and MergeRebase and MergeCommit History

AI 요약

Beta

이 글은 GitHub에서 제공하는 세 가지 병합(Merge) 방식인 Merge, Squash and Merge, Rebase and Merge의 차이점을 설명하고, 각 방식이 커밋 히스토리에 미치는 영향을 그래프와 함께 시각적으로 보여줍니다. 각 병합 방식의 특징을 이해함으로써 개발 프로젝트의 커밋 히스토리를 깔끔하게 관리하고, 팀원들과의 협업 효율성을 높이는 데 도움을 줄 수 있습니다.

특히, 메인 브랜치의 관점에서 각 병합 방식이 어떻게 커밋 구조를 형성하는지 상세히 분석하여, 어떤 상황에 어떤 병합 방식을 선택하는 것이 가장 적합한지에 대한 가이드라인을 제시합니다.

이 글이 궁금하신가요?

원문 블로그에서 전체 내용을 확인해 보세요

원문 읽으러 가기

AI 추천 연관 게시글

이 글과 관련된 다른 기술 블로그 글을 AI가 추천합니다